More about the property

Occupying a pleasant position within the popular village of Cranwell, this beautifully presented three-bedroom semi-detached home has been finished to an exceptional standard throughout, offering stylish, move-in-ready accommodation that is ideal for first-time buyers, growing families or those looking to downsize without compromise.

The accommodation extends to approximately 941 sq ft and is thoughtfully arranged over two floors. The welcoming entrance hall leads to a spacious lounge, providing a bright and comfortable living space perfect for relaxing. To the rear of the property is a modern fitted kitchen, complemented by a separate utility room and an impressive dining room, creating the ideal space for both everyday family life and entertaining guests. To the first floor are two well-proportioned bedrooms, both presented to a high standard, together with a contemporary shower room fitted with a modern suite, the top floor is completed by a walk in wardrobe (initially a 3rd bedroom, with scope to reinstate).

Outside, the property continues to impress with off-road parking to the side, while the gardens provide an attractive setting to enjoy throughout the year.

Situated in the sought-after village of Cranwell, the property enjoys excellent access to local amenities, schools and transport links, with the market town of Sleaford just a short drive away.

Presented in immaculate condition throughout, this is a superb opportunity to purchase a home that requires nothing more than moving in and enjoying. Early viewing is highly recommended to fully appreciate the quality of accommodation on offer.

Stamp Duty Land Tax

Below is an illustration of the Stamp Duty Land Tax ("Stamp Duty") that would be payable, based on a set of assumptions. You should always check your stamp duty liability and any other costs due with your solicitor or conveyancer.

£2200 would need to be paid in stamp duty on purchasing this property, assuming that you are purchasing freehold, purchasing as an individual (or jointly with someone else), and this will be your only property.

First Time Buyers may claim a discount (relief) on purchases of £625,000 and under.

The stamp duty for first time buyers would therefore be £0.
